The IS or as known in the West as JS – series of tanks were named after Soviet leader
Iosif – Joseph- Stalin. This tank was lighter and faster than the KV series tanks and was
designed mainly as a breakthrough tank. The crew could fire high-explosive shells at
trenches and bunkers as well as German tanks. The new A-19 122mm gun delivered its
shells with 3.5 times the kinetic energy of the older 76.2mm gun. This gave it excellent
armor penetrating ability but even when the shell didn’t penetrate the armor it often
knocked the turret off the tank with a combination of impact and explosion. This huge gun
also gave the JS-2 its disadvantage. The ammunition was in two parts and very difficult
for the crew to manhandle. This meant a slow rate of fire of about 2 rounds per minute
and the size meant only 28 shells could be carried.

A Front (Soviet army group) consists of several field armies of between 400,000 – 1.5
million troops that are usually responsible for a particular geographic area and
commanded by a single General or Field Marshal. In early 1945 the 1st Ukrainian Front
was involved in the “Vistula-Oder Strategic Offensive”. This offensive began at the
Vistula River in Poland in mid January 1945 and lasted about 3 weeks. Soviet forces
engaged German troops in numerous battles and forced them back to the Oder River
that is about 50 miles from Berlin. After this the 1st took part in the advance to Leipzig,
Dresden and finally Prague. On June 10, 1945 the 1st was disbanded.
Specifications JS-2

Crew:   4

Dimensions
Length (with gun):  10.74m  (35.24 ft)
Height:    2.93m    (9.61 ft)
Weight:   46,250 kg    (101963.8 lb)

Performance
Engine:   V-2 IS 12cyl. Diesel-engine/520hp
Speed:    37km/h  (22.99 mph)
Range:    150km   (93.2 mi)


Armor:   20mm - 160mm  (.79 in - 6.3 in)

Armament:    1 X 122mm (4.8 in)  M1943 D-25T L/43 gun
1 x 12.7mm (.5 in) M1938 DShK
1 x 7.62mm  (.3 in)  DT/DTM

Ammunition:  28 x 122mm shells
2331 x DT rounds
300 x DShK rounds
